I want my radio position to move with a network entity, how do I do this?

For DIS use the Entity Attach object, which is found on the World Position submenu of the Controls list. Populating this object with the necessary fields (site, host, entity IDs) and connecting it to the World Position field of a radio, transmitter or receiver will cause it to move with a network entity. If the network entity is not present then the Entity Attach object will resort to the values contained in the Default Position field.
Note: Monitor Radios and net intercom objects will not move with network entity objects. These objects use DIS world positions for identification purposes only and do not use or require ranging effects.
For those of you who need to implement this in HLA see the ASTi application note #52: "Entity Attachment Over HLA".
